个人简介

2022.10-至今,北京理工大学,集成电路与电子学院,预聘副教授 2020.06-2022.10,北京理工大学,集成电路与电子学院,特立博士后 2017.10-2018.10,美国麻省理工学院,电子工程与计算机科学系,联合培养博士生(CSC) 2016.08-2020.06,清华大学,集成电路学院,博士 2013.08-2016.06,清华大学,微电子与纳电子学系,硕士 2009.09-2013.07,华北电力大学(北京),电气工程及其自动化系,本科 研究成果 围绕我国在“新一代微纳电子器件”领域的重大需求,在基于低维纳米材料及其异质结构的可控合成、新型微纳电子器件结构设计以及新型神经形态信息器件研制等方面具有丰富的研究成果,在Nature Nanotechnology, Nature Communications, Advanced Materials等国际著名学术期刊及会议上发表学术论文60余篇,总引用1700余次,H-index为23。其中,以第一作者(含共同一作)或通讯作者在Nature Communications (1篇), InfoMat (1篇),Advanced Functional Materials (2篇), Advanced Optical Materials (1篇), Nano Research (2篇)等国际著名期刊发表SCI论文23篇,EI论文3篇。 主持课题 国家自然科学基金,青年项目,基于铁电栅硫化钼场效应晶体管的类视网膜神经形态传感器的制备与性能研究,2022.01-2024.12,30万,在研,主持 中国博士后基金,博士后创新人才支持计划,混合维度异质结光敏突触器件及其在神经形态信息技术领域的应用,2020.06-2022.10,63万,结题,主持 中国博士后基金,面上资助一等,基于有机铁电栅硫化钼场效 应晶体管的柔性可编程逻辑门器件的基础研究,2021.06-2022.10,12万,结题,主持 荣获奖项 指导本科生参加2022年北京市大学生集成电路设计大赛,获一等奖3项、二等奖2项、三等奖1项 2021年度北京理工大学优秀博士后 2010年本科生国家奖学金,2015年硕士研究生国家奖学金,2019年博士研究生国家奖学金

研究领域

低维神经形态信息器件及系统、功能化范德华异质结器件设计与制备、新型二维层状半导体电子器件、电路及系统
